Things to Consider When Using the Design

While the Groovy Aesthetic Flower Rainbow is visually appealing, there are some practical considerations to keep in mind:

  1. Small Hoop Sizes: If you plan to embroider this design in a compact area, such as on a hat or small pillow, consider resizing carefully. The original layout might require a larger hoop than expected.
  2. Dense Stitch Areas: Some parts of the design have tighter stitch patterns. I recommend testing these sections first to avoid puckering, especially on stretchy or thin materials.
  3. Thread Color Contrast: The design uses a variety of thread colors to create the rainbow effect. For best results, choose threads that contrast well with your base fabric. Dark backgrounds will need brighter shades to maintain visibility.
  4. Textured or Stretchy Fabrics: This design performed well on cotton blends and non-stretch materials. For stretchier fabrics like knits, I used a tear-away stabilizer underneath to help preserve the shape and prevent distortion.
  5. Frequent Washing: Since this design is intended for baby items and household goods, I tested it after multiple wash cycles. The stitches held up nicely, showing minimal fraying or loosening. Proper backing and stabilizer choice are key here.
